The adjunct faculty member is responsible for providing clinical instruction to students and facilitating a learning environment that encourages critical thinking. They must also evaluate student progress, maintain academic records, and stay current with trends in the nursing discipline.
Candidates are required to hold a Bachelor's degree in Nursing, with a Master's degree preferred. Prior collegiate-level teaching experience of 3 or more years is also preferred.
